The oxidative dehydrogenation of alcohols represents key steps in the synthesis of aldehyde, ketone, ester, and acid intermediates employed within the fine chemical, pharmaceutical, and agrochemical sectors, with allylic aldehydes in particular high-value components used in the perfume and fiavoring industries [1]. For example, crotonaldehyde is an important agrochemical and a valuable precursor for the food preservative sorbic acid, while citronellyl acetate and cinnamaldehyde confer rose/fruity and cinnamon flavors and aromas, respectively. The construction of carbon-carbon bonds is one of the most important transformations in organic synthesis, and considerable research efforts have been directed towards the development of new methods in this area. Importantly, transformations of this type provide access to a wide variety of organic compounds that can be used as synthetic building blocks in the fine chemical and pharmaceutical industries, as well as key intermediates in the preparation of dmgs and functional materials. [Pg.268]
